Output 8e834039b23b57e4a3bc5bc8c1d6d51010ba68ffef00e40f4a92af81ccc2b1b9:14

value
13766860
script pubkey
OP_0 OP_PUSHBYTES_20 73089fd19ac090b09e48c1178808f2cfc8f92f49
address
bc1qwvyfl5v6czgtp8jgcytcsz8jely0jt6fhjcnsf
transaction
8e834039b23b57e4a3bc5bc8c1d6d51010ba68ffef00e40f4a92af81ccc2b1b9
spent
true